2 hours ago, GDRRiley said:

I have my main rig folding 10,300 points on CPU (4.3 on all) , GPU 1360 points. I may get a old server soon and that might turn into a folding@home run. These are just what it says as I just started will run most of the time.

I just got a dell poweredge 1950 iii (dual xeon E5405s, 15 GBs of ram) last night and it does not put out very many points.  you might just want to get a used 290 or a 680 and throw it in your main rig.

 

Edit: forgot to mention if you do go the server route make sure your server's PSU has spare pcie connectors.  A lot of OEM servers PSU's don't come with extra cables for expansion so you'd either have to use graphics cards that are under 75Ws or put in a new PSU which might need some ghetto modding to do.
